Nathan Chan
(born 1993) is an American
cellist
from
Hillsborough, CA
. He has performed with the
San Francisco Symphony
,
The Royal Philharmonic Orchestra
, and the
Albany Symphony Orchestra
, among others.He was featured in the
HBO
Show, "The Music in Me: Children's Recitals From Classical to Latin to Jazz to Zydeco" as well as
Channel 4
's "The World's Greatest Musical Prodigies".
